1. Introduction
The VEVOR 15x15 Heat Press Machine is designed for efficient and precise heat transfer applications on various materials. This digital industrial sublimation printer is suitable for both heat transfer vinyl (HTV) and sublimation projects, offering fast heating and high-pressure capabilities. This manual provides essential information for safe and effective operation.
Key Features:
- 15 x 15 Heat Press: Large heating pad (38 x 38 cm) with sponge, designed for a service life of 20,000 hours. Ensures quicker heating and better transfer effects. Soft heating liner accommodates various materials and reduces odors.
- Digital Control Board: Precise control panel for accurate temperature and time regulation. Features an automatic alarm upon completion. Temperature Range: 0 - 482 ℉ / 0 - 250 ℃; Time Control: 0 - 999 seconds; Power: 1200 W; Voltage: 110 V.
- Teflon Insulation Coating: Revolutionary Teflon material reduces surface temperature for user comfort and minimizes scratches. Lessens adhesion risk between clothes and platen for excellent transfer results.
- Adjustable Pressure Knob: Full-range knob for increasing or decreasing pressure based on material thickness. Outfitted with a non-slip rubber grip for comfortable use.
- Easy to Use: Ideal for creating personalized gifts on T-shirts, pillows, bags, phone shells, and quickly transferring colorful pictures and characters onto textiles like cotton, cloth, HTV, ceramics, glasses, fabrics, flax, and nylon.
2. Important Safety Instructions
- Always operate the heat press on a stable, flat, and heat-resistant surface.
- Keep hands and body clear of the heating plate during operation to prevent burns. The Teflon coating reduces surface temperature but the plate remains hot.
- Ensure proper ventilation in the work area to dissipate any odors or fumes.
- Do not leave the machine unattended while it is powered on or operating.
- Unplug the heat press from the power outlet when not in use or before cleaning/maintenance.
- Keep out of reach of children and pets.
- Use heat-resistant gloves when handling hot materials or adjusting the machine after pressing.
- Avoid overloading electrical circuits. The machine operates at 1200W, 110V.

4. Setup
- Unpacking: Carefully remove the heat press from its packaging. Retain all packaging materials for future storage or transport.
- Placement: Place the machine on a sturdy, flat, and heat-resistant surface. Ensure there is adequate space around the machine for safe operation and ventilation.
- Power Connection: Plug the power cord into a grounded 110V electrical outlet.
- Initial Inspection: Check all components for any signs of damage. Ensure the heating plate and platen are clean and free of debris.
5. Operating Instructions
5.1. Setting Temperature and Time:
- Power On: Flip the red power switch located on the side of the control box to the "ON" position.
- Set Temperature: Use the "TEMP" button and the up/down arrows on the digital control board to set the desired temperature (0 - 482 ℉ / 0 - 250 ℃). The machine will begin heating automatically.
- Set Time: Use the "TIME" button and the up/down arrows to set the desired pressing duration (0 - 999 seconds).
- Pre-heating: Allow the machine to reach the set temperature. The display will show the current temperature rising until it matches the set value.

5.2. Adjusting Pressure:
The pressure is adjusted using the full-range knob located on top of the heating plate assembly. Turn the knob clockwise to increase pressure and counter-clockwise to decrease pressure. Adjust based on the thickness of your material and transfer type. Test with scrap material to find the optimal pressure.
5.3. Heat Transfer Process:
- Prepare Material: Place your garment or material onto the silicone pad on the lower platen. Smooth out any wrinkles. For best results, pre-press the garment for 3-5 seconds to remove moisture and wrinkles.
- Position Transfer: Carefully place your heat transfer vinyl (HTV) or sublimation paper onto the garment in the desired position.
- Cover with Teflon Sheet: Place a Teflon sheet over your transfer and garment. This protects the heating plate and prevents ink transfer.
- Press: Lower the heating plate handle until it locks into place. The timer will automatically start counting down.
- Alarm: Once the set time expires, an alarm will sound. Lift the handle to release the pressure.
- Remove Transfer: Carefully remove the Teflon sheet. Depending on your transfer type (hot peel, warm peel, cold peel), wait for the material to cool sufficiently before peeling off the transfer backing.

5.4. Recommended Parameters:
| Material | Textile | Temp | Time | Note |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| PU HTV | Cotton, Polyester, etc | 150-165℃ / 302-329℉ | 10-15s | Cold/Warm Peel |
| Glitter HTV | Cotton, Polyester, etc | 155-165℃ / 343-361℉ | 10-15s | Cold/Warm Peel |
| Sublimation Paper | Polyester, Cotton≥30%, etc | 180-200℃ / 356-392℉ | 40-60s | Cold Peel |
| Heat Transfer Paper (Dark Fabric) | 100% Cotton | 155-165℃ / 343-361℉ | 10-15s | - |
| Heat Transfer Paper (Light Fabric) | 100% Cotton | 155-165℃ / 343-361℉ | 10-15s | - |
Note: These are general recommendations. Always refer to the specific instructions provided with your transfer materials.

6. Maintenance
- Cleaning: Regularly wipe down the heating plate and silicone pad with a soft, damp cloth after the machine has cooled completely. Do not use abrasive cleaners.
- Teflon Sheet Care: Replace the Teflon sheet if it becomes damaged or excessively dirty to ensure optimal transfer quality and protection for the heating plate.
- Storage: Store the heat press in a dry, dust-free environment when not in use.
7. Troubleshooting
| Problem | Possible Cause | Solution |
|---|---|---|
| Uneven transfer/fading | Incorrect pressure, temperature, or time; moisture in garment. | Adjust pressure knob; verify temperature/time settings; pre-press garment to remove moisture. |
| Machine not heating | Power issue, faulty heating element. | Check power connection and outlet; contact customer support if issue persists. |
| Transfers peeling/not adhering | Insufficient heat or pressure; incorrect peel method (hot/cold). | Increase temperature/pressure slightly; ensure correct peel method for your material. |
| Burning smell during operation | Excessive temperature; material burning; new machine odor. | Reduce temperature; ensure proper material compatibility; new machine odor is normal initially. |
8. Specifications
- Plate Size: 15 x 15 in / 38 x 38 cm
- Product Dimensions: 14.96 x 14.96 x 13.66 inches
- Upper Temperature Rating: 482 Degrees Fahrenheit (250 Degrees Celsius)
- Voltage: 110 Volts
- Power: 1200 W
- Time Control: 0 - 999 seconds
- Net Weight: 41.4 lb / 18.8 kg
